I have new fish coming and would like to know if my QT plan is sound:

Striated Tang
Yellow Tang
Sailfin Tang
Valentini Puffer

1. Observe all fish for a few days in my 20g QT. Establish all are eating properly.
2. Start General Cure treatment as per @Humblefish instructions (7 day between doses)
3. Remove Puffer and place in Observation. (I don't want to expose him to step 4)
4. 30 day Copper Power treatment for Tangs using Hanna checker.
5. Sometime in that month introduce puffer to DT so he can get established.
6. Introduce Tang Gang when copper complete.

Obviously, I dont want the puffer exposed to Copper. Hopeful that the observation in addition to General Cure will be sufficient for him.

Thanks ya'all!
 
You'll have to watch the ammonia level in a 20 gallon with 3 tangs and a puffer. Water changes will be the way to deal, since you can't combine Prime with Copper.

I wouldn't personally do 30 days of copper, although it sounds like a lot of folks do that. Half that length should be plenty, assuming the fish will go into a display without disease.

How do puffers handle General Cure? What about using Tank Transfer Method on the puffer, to at least cover ich?

Great call on the ammonia. Will watch it like a hawk. Running at least one AQ70 seeded with bio and have another one ready to go.

I don’t know much about the puffer handling the General Cure. Hoping someone with experience chimes in. TTM on puffer is also a solid plan.
 
Some puffers don't like treating with General Cure. It may put off a bit their eating. But usually rebounds as the GC dissipates from the water column.

I have put puffers through Copper Power. Very slowly raising the levels to 2.0 over 5-7 days or so. Small doses spread out AM, PM is the best so you can watch for a copper sensitive fish. But there is a risk with puffers, make no mistake about it. Watch for lethargy, not eating, labored breathing; all signs of copper sensitivity.
